Flight Attendants salary in Chicago-Naperville-Elgin, IL-IN
SOC 53-2031 · BLS OEWS May 2025
Median
$62,120
per year in Chicago-Naperville-Elgin, IL-IN
Middle half
$60,320–$77,720
25th to 75th percentile
Employed
9,240
in Chicago-Naperville-Elgin, IL-IN
Concentration
2.42×
share of workforce vs. U.S.
How local pay compares
Chicago-Naperville-Elgin, IL-IN
$62,120
published median
United States
$63,580
2.3% below the national median
Rank among metro areas
16th
27 with a published estimate
State-level comparison: Illinois ($62,120). Metro estimates cover the whole labor market, including portions that cross state lines.
After local prices: the $62,120 median has purchasing power comparable to about $59,964 nationally. Chicago-Naperville-Elgin, IL-IN's BEA regional price parity is 103.6 (2024).

Getting in
- Typical education to enter
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Related work experience
- Less than 5 years
- On-the-job training
- Moderate-term on-the-job training
